#d0d60f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d0d60f is composed of 81.6% red, 83.9%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 93%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 61.8 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 44.9%. #d0d60f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1e with #a1ad00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#d0d60f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d0d60f has RGB values of R:208, G:214,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13686287.

Shades and Tints of #d0d60f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0c01 is the darkest color, while #fefff9 is the lightest one.
